Kaleb Johnson came to play in Week 7 against the Washington Huskies.

In the 1st quarter, Johnson opened up the scoring with a 6-yard TD run. Then, the RB found the end zone again in the  2nd quarter on an 18-yard receiving TD.

The junior RB secured a hat trick at the start of the 4th quarter with an 8-yard scamper to put the Hawkeyes up 30-10.

This is Johnson’s 2nd game with 3 TDs in 2024.  The first came against Minnesota when the RB rushed for 206 yards and 3 scores. The Hawkeyes went on to win that game 31-14.

Johnson has surpassed the 100-yard mark again, meaning the RB has hit that mark in all but 1 game in 2024. Johnson has also scored at least 2 TDs in every game except 1.

About halfway through the 4th quarter, Johnson has 166 yards and 2 rushing scores on 21 carries. The RB has also caught 3 passes for 22 yards and 1 TD. The Hawkeyes are in control of the Huskies, winning 40-10 at home.

This win would be big for the Hawkeyes who are looking to rebound after suffering a bad loss to Ohio State last weekend. A win would move the team to 4-2 overall with a 2-1 record in the conference.

Heading into Week 7, Johnson was No. 2 in the country in rushing yards with 771 and is also No. 2 in yards per game with 154.20. Johnson trails only Boise State’s Ashton Jeanty in those categories and was tied for 3rd in rushing scores with 10.
